The specific problem you posed is due to cancellation error.  It should 
not require extra precision.

If you want to resurrect the long double functions that used
to exist, look at djgpp/src/libc/ansi/math.  For the most part
you just need to change instructions like fldl to fldt and fix
a few constants from double to long double.


: ``Long double'' and ``fast'' don't live together well enough ;-).

In x86 coprocessors, not only the arithmetic but also the elementary
functions like log and tan are computed in long double anyway,
so there is essentially no speed difference.


: The new libm from the beta release of v2.02 should be more accurate,
: so you might give it a try.

In many cases the new libm is actually less accurate than the
coprocessor functions because the coprocessor results are long
double but fdlibm was not designed to take advantage of long double.
Consequently the fdlibm functions have more roundoff error.
For practical calculations there is no reason to prefer the new libm
over the coprocessor.
